Corolla, CR-V, Ram Nab Green Vehicle Awards

Green Car Journal has named the Toyota Corolla, Honda CR-V and Ram 1500 pickup as its Green Car, SUV and Truck models of the year, respectively.

The winners are selected by GCJ editors and a panel of jurors from national environmental and energy efficiency organizations. This is the 15th year of the awards.

The Corolla and CR-V are available with conventional stand-alone piston engines and hybrid-electric variants. The Corolla Hybrid has a U.S. Environmental Protection Agency fuel efficiency rating of 53 mpg in the city and 52 mpg on the highway.

The winning Ram 1500 (pictured) teams a 3.0-liter V-6 EcoDiesel engine with a mild-hybrid system. The truck gets 32 mpg on the highway, generates 480 lb-ft of torque and has a towing capacity of nearly 12,600 lbs.
